I recently put new wheels on my 90 GT and I noticed that the wheels rub at full lock. I bought a couple steering rack limiters to correct this. I looked up directions on the internet and it says to turn the steering all the way to the right and put one clip on. Then turn the steering all the way to the left and put another clip on. Do I need to put both clips on? I was under the impression when I bought them that I might only have to use one, but I bought two just in case I needed it.
